The Jangam-dong Community Center in Uijeongbu-si, Gyeonggi Province (Director Lee Jae-jin) announced that the Jangam Buckwheat Flower Village Festival Promotion Committee (Chairman Park Beom-seo) successfully held the Jangam Buckwheat Flower Village Festival on the 12th at the Jungnangcheon Water Rest Area.
The Jangam Buckwheat Flower Village Festival Promotion Committee was formed centered around the Jangam-dong Residents' Autonomy Association, consisting of 10 self-governing organizations (▲Tongjang Council ▲Senior Citizens Association ▲Sports Promotion Association ▲Saemaeul Leaders Council ▲Saemaeul Women's Association ▲Committee for the Right Living Movement ▲Youth Guidance Council ▲Volunteer Crime Prevention Unit ▲Community Social Security Council).
This festival is the first fully resident-led village event in the district, breaking away from government-led forms, with residents independently leading everything from budgeting to planning and execution.
On the day, various experience spaces (booths), cultural performances, sharing markets, and food stalls were operated so that all residents could participate and enjoy. It provided joy to children and healing to adults, realizing the image of a village festival where residents are happy and united.
Chairman Park Beom-seo said, “I hope this festival becomes a sustainable village festival that sets the blueprint as the first resident-led festival,” and added, “We will continue to strive to make Jangam-dong a better place for residents to live.”
Mayor Kim Dong-geun said, “We will work to ensure that village festivals that communicate and resonate with residents continue to develop and be sustained.”
